Le Galion Snob Extrait is a men's perfume extract launched by the Le Galion brand in 1952.
The fragrance belongs to the floral family and was created by perfumer Paul Vacher, whose name is associated with the elegant French school of perfumery.
The history of Le Galion began in 1930, when the brand was founded by Prince Murat, a descendant of one of Napoleon's marshals.
Snob Extrait reflects the brand's aristocratic heritage and the aesthetics of its era, when a men's fragrance could be not only austere and woody, but also distinctly floral.
The composition features hyacinth, jasmine, cade juniper, rose and musk. Together, they create a floral, white-floral and woody-musky profile with a pronounced vintage character.
Snob Extrait does not unfold according to a classic fragrance pyramid: the available information does not list the top, middle and base notes separately.
It is therefore best experienced as a cohesive accord in which the cool green facet of juniper highlights the softness of rose and jasmine, while musk lends the scent depth and a lasting aftertaste.
Le Galion Snob Extrait is presented in parfum concentration — the richest format, designed for a pronounced and long-lasting presence.
The fragrance is described as having very strong sillage, making it especially suitable for cool weather, evenings and occasions when you want to emphasize your individuality.
No precise recommendation for the number of sprays on skin or clothing is provided.
Given the extract's high intensity, it is sensible to start with a minimal amount and observe how it develops on the skin, gradually adding more if necessary.
Despite its positioning as a men's fragrance, its floral palette makes it appealing to anyone who enjoys expressive retro compositions with white flowers, rose, green facets and a musky base.
It is a choice for admirers of noble, noticeable perfumes with character, rather than for those seeking a light and almost weightless everyday fragrance.

In the available data, the top, middle, and base notes are not listed separately, so the composition is presented as a blended list of accords.
Hyacinth, jasmine, and rose take center stage, creating an expressive floral character. Cade juniper adds a cool green woody nuance and gives the bouquet a more cohesive structure.
Musk softens the composition, enhances its depth, and supports a lasting trail. Overall, the fragrance combines floral, white-floral, woody, and musky nuances.
